What is Tomra Systems ASA Margin of Safety % (DCF Earnings Based)?

Margin of Safety % (DCF Earnings Based) = (Intrinsic Value: DCF (Earnings Based) - Current Price) / Intrinsic Value: DCF (Earnings Based).

Note: Discounted Earnings model is only suitable for predictable companies (Business Predictability Rank higher than 1-Star). If the company's Predictability Rank is 1-Star or Not Rated, result may not be accurate due to the low predictability of business and the data will not be stored into our database.

As of today (2025-06-20), Tomra Systems ASA's Predictability Rank is 4.5-Stars. Tomra Systems ASA's intrinsic value calculated from the Discounted Earnings model is kr59.79 and current share price is kr160.90. Consequently,

Tomra Systems ASA's Margin of Safety % (DCF Earnings Based) using Discounted Earnings model is -169.11%.

Tomra Systems ASA Margin of Safety % (DCF Earnings Based) Calculation

Tomra Systems ASA's Margin of Safety % (DCF Earnings Based) for today is calculated as

Margin of Safety % (DCF Earnings Based)=(Intrinsic Value: DCF (Earnings Based)-Current Price)/Intrinsic Value: DCF (Earnings Based)
=(59.79-160.90)/59.79
=-169.11 %

The intrinsic value is calculated from the Discounted Earnings model with default parameters. The calculation method is the same as Discounted Cash Flow model except earnings are used in the calculation instead of free cash flow.

Tomra Systems ASA provides sorting and recycling solutions to equip customers for handling waste. The company creates and delivers sensor-based solutions that contribute to optimal resource productivity, in packaging, collection, compaction, recycling, ore sorting, and food production. It provides reverse vending machines, sensor-based sorting machines integrated post-harvest solutions, sensors for waste sorting applications, and other related products and solutions. The company's operating segments are; TOMRA Collection which generates key revenue, TOMRA Recycling, TOMRA Horizon, and TOMRA Food. Geographically, the company generates maximum revenue from Europe (excluding Northern Europe), followed by Northern Europe, America, Asia, and Oceania.
